HTML是一种用于创建网页的标记语言。它可以与其他编程语言(如CSS和JavaScript)结合使用,以创建动态和交互式的网站。如果您需要将HTML与编程专家评测相结合,您可以使用在线代码运行工具,例如CodePen或JSFiddle,以便在浏览器中实时预览您的代码 。
在当今的数字化时代,网页设计和开发已经成为了一项至关重要的技能,随着技术的不断发展,越来越多的企业和个人开始关注网页的外观和功能,为了满足这一需求,HTML(超文本标记语言)应运而生,它是一种用于创建网页的标准标记语言,本文将详细介绍如何将HTML与其他编程语言相结合,以实现更高效、更实用的网页设计和开发。
我们需要了解HTML的基本结构,HTML文档由一系列的元素组成,这些元素按照特定的标签进行分组,标题可以使用<h1>
到<h6>
之间的标签表示,段落则使用<p>
标签表示,HTML还支持一些属性,如class
、id
和style
,用于为元素添加额外的信息和样式。
我们将探讨如何将HTML与其他编程语言相结合,我们将以Python为例,介绍如何使用Python的web框架(如Django和Flask)来实现HTML与后端代码的交互。
1、Django框架
Django是一个基于Python的高级Web框架,它鼓励快速开发和干净、实用的设计,通过使用Django,我们可以轻松地将HTML与后端代码相结合,以下是一个简单的示例:
安装Django:
pip install django
创建一个新的Django项目:
django-admin startproject myproject cd myproject
创建一个名为myapp
的新应用:
python manage.py startapp myapp
在myapp
目录下的views.py
文件中,编写一个简单的视图函数:
from django.http import HttpResponse from django.template import loader from django.shortcuts import render def index(request): template = loader.get_template('index.html') return HttpResponse(template.render())
在myapp
目录下创建一个名为templates
的文件夹,并在其中创建一个名为index.html
的文件:
<!DOCTYPE html> <html> <head> <title>我的第一个Django页面</title> </head> <body> <h1>欢迎来到我的网站!</h1> <p>这是一个使用Django和HTML相结合的简单示例。</p> </body> </html>
在项目的urls.py
文件中,将URL与视图函数关联起来:
from django.contrib import admin from django.urls import path from myapp.views import index urlpatterns = [ path('admin/', admin.site.urls), path('', index, name='index'), ]
运行Django开发服务器:
python manage.py runserver
打开浏览器,访问http://127.0.0.1:8000/
,你将看到刚刚编写的HTML页面已经成功显示在屏幕上,这就是一个简单的将HTML与Python后端代码相结合的示例。